Wood window service encompasses a range of professional sol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ring traditional wooden windows. These services often include tasks such as repairing rotted or damaged wood, replacing broken or malfunctioning parts, and refinishing or repainting to improve appearance and durability. Skilled technicians assess the condition of existing wood windows and recommend appropriate interventions to extend their lifespan and ensure they function properly. Proper maintenance and repairs help preserve the aesthetic appeal and historical integrity of wooden windows, especially on older or heritage properties.
Addressing common issues, wood window services help solve problems like drafts, difficulty opening or closing, and water infiltration. Over time, wood can warp, crack, or decay due to ex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ations. These issues can lead to increased energy costs, security concerns, and further structural damage if left unaddressed. Professional service providers can identify underlying problems and perform targeted repairs or replacements, preventing more extensive damage and restoring the window’s original performance.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bloomingdale,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ing wood windows typically costs between $300 and $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ard-sized window in Bloomingdale might fall within this range. Costs can vary based on the complexity of installation and materials used.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ows generally ranges from $150 to $600 per window. Common repairs include sash replacement or frame restoration, with prices influenced by the extent of damage and local labor rates. Some minor fixes may cost less, while extensive repairs could be higher.
Refinishing and Restoring - Refinishing wood windows typically costs around $200 to $500 per window. This includes sanding, staining, and sealing to restore appearance and function. The final price depends on the condition of the wood and the level of detail required.
Material and Labor Variations - Costs vary based on the type of wood, hardware, and the complexity of installation or repair. Local service providers in Bloomingdale may charge different rates, with overall expenses influenced by project scope and specific service needs. Contact local pros for precise est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of services are available for wood window repair? Local service providers offer repairs such as sash replacement, frame restoration, and sealing to improve window performance and appearance.
Can wood windows be customized or modified? Yes, local pros can assist with custom sizing, design modifications, and finishing options to match existing styles or preferences.
What is involved in wood window restoration? Restoration services typically include stripping old paint or finish, repairing damaged wood, and applying protective coatings to extend the window's lifespan.
Are there options for upgrading to energy-efficient wood windows? Many service providers offer upgrades that improve insulation and energy efficiency while maintaining the traditional look of wood windows.
